    | 1. Sprinkle steaks with dried onion, ¼ teaspoon salt and pepper. | 2. Heat 1 tablespoon o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. | 3. Add the steaks and decrease heat to medium. | 4. Cook, turning once, until desired doneness, 3 to 6 minutes per side for med-rare. | 5. Transfer the steaks to a plate; tent with foil. | 6. Position a rack in upper third of oven; preheat broiler. | 7. Add the remaining 1 tablespoon oil to the pan. | 8. Add onions and sherry, cover and cook over med-high heat, stirring occasionally, until the onions are tender and golden brown and the liquid has evaporated, 10-12 minutes. | 9. Sprinkle flour over the onions and stir to coat. | 10. Add broth, thyme and the remaining ¼ teaspoon salt; cook until bubbling and thickened, about 1 minute more. | 11. Remove from the heat and return the steaks and any accumulated juice to the pan. | 12. Pile up some of the onions on top of the steaks. | 13. Top each steak with a slice of baguette and some cheese. | 14. Transfer the pan to the oven and broil until the cheese is melted and bubbling, about 2 minutes. | 15. Serve the steaks with the onions and sauce. | 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
